A few weeks ago, Father John announced that the Club had received a grant from the Mabel Riley Foundation for a new teen center to be constructed in the space formerly occupied by the Savio shower rooms and locker area. Well, Joe Mario’s crew lost no time in cranking up the next phase of their project.
Actually, the check had not even cleared the bank when walls started coming down and workers started clearing mountains of debris. Even a casual visitor to the Club would not fail to notice the dust cloud that settled over much of the building!
The new center will include an area for games, a lounge area, a small computer center, and a snack area for those insatiable teen-age appetites! There will be an office/work area for a full-time Teen Center Director. In effect, the new space will function as a “club within a club” for the older members. It may even have its own dedicated entrance.
Why all this? Boys & Girls Clubs all over the country have experienced difficulty in keeping older club members around. There is a definite drop in enrollment after the age of 13–not only here, but across the nation. Teens want a space they can call “their own.” Their needs are different; they need slightly different programming, and a little less structure than the younger members. In short, they need to know that, when they come to the Club, they do not have to spend all their time “escaping their little brothers and sisters!”
Father John expects that, if all goes according to schedule, the new teen center will be ready for use in September 2010. According to him, the hardest part now will be “deciding what furniture goes where!”
